Transaction 7989504231e2e8191cf790c4306f0280c63e80ef57d596f6fd6c301bb2ccd500

1 Input
2 Outputs
  • 7989504231e2e8191cf790c4306f0280c63e80ef57d596f6fd6c301bb2ccd500:0
  • value  27219792
    address  12fXG8R2eAUXpMN5v6j59brf1xANNjQcSy
  • 7989504231e2e8191cf790c4306f0280c63e80ef57d596f6fd6c301bb2ccd500:1
  • value  1605598531
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v